Dietary Sodium
The amount of sodium consumed in the diet, often monitored for its effects on blood pressure and heart health.
Oral Contraceptives
Medications taken by mouth to prevent pregnancy, containing hormones that inhibit ovulation.
Kegel Exercises
Pelvic floor exercises aimed at strengthening the muscles under the uterus, bladder, and bowel (large intestine).
Perineal Exercises
Exercises aimed at strengthening the muscles of the pelvic floor, often recommended to improve bladder control and sexual function.
